A West Broward man is facing multiple charges, including attempted murder, after authorities say he shot a man who was carrying a baby at a Lauderhill apartment complex.
Tasaini Da Shoniel Graham, 26, is accused of shooting the man on the 7000 block of Environ Boulevard on Thursday afternoon.
An investigation conducted by Lauderhill police found Graham entered an elevator with the victim and child, who was being carried in a car seat. The trio road the elevator to the ground floor of a parking garage, where Graham then allegedly shot the victim in the back.
The man, whose name was not disclosed, is at the Broward Health Medical Center in stable condition, police said.
The infant was reportedly unhurt.
According to court and jail records, Graham was charged with attempted felony murder, aggravated assault with intent to commit a felony, and child abuse without great bodily harm. No defense attorney is named.
Graham is being held without bond at the Broward County Main Jail, according to records which also list Graham as a Plantation resident.
Police said the investigation is continuing.
